ErZrRu2 is an intermetallic compound combining erbium, zirconium, and ruthenium, representing a ternary metal system likely of research interest for advanced high-temperature or specialty applications. This material family is typically explored for potential use in extreme environments or functional applications where the combination of rare earth (erbium), refractory (zirconium), and transition metal (ruthenium) elements may offer unique magnetic, thermal, or electronic properties. As an experimental compound, ErZrRu2 remains primarily in the research phase; engineers would consider it only for specialized development programs targeting novel functionality rather than established industrial applications.
